Introduction

Diabetes Mellitus (DM) is a complex metabolic disorder characterized by hyperglycemia due to defects in insulin secretion and action. The condition can be understood through both modern medical perspectives and traditional Ayurvedic concepts. In Ayurveda, DM is referred to as Madhumeha and is classified into two types based on body constitution: Sthula (obese) and Krish (lean). Treatment strategies aim to balance the underlying doshas, emphasizing the importance of therapeutic procedures like Virechana (purification therapy) for managing symptoms and improving insulin resistance, particularly in cases of Sthula Madhumeha.

Virechana: A Key Ayurvedic Intervention

Virechana is an Ayurvedic therapeutic procedure classified as Shodhana, which is aimed at detoxifying and purifying the body. It is particularly indicated for managing Sthula Madhumeha. The process involves the use of specific herbal formulations, such as Panchatikta Ghrita, which possess properties that help normalize Kapha and Pitta doshas. This intervention not only facilitates the removal of accumulated doshas from the body but also stabilizes metabolic functions, thus potentially reducing obesity and improving insulin sensitivity. By administering Virechana, the study suggests that a significant reduction in insulin resistance, as measured by HOMA-IR, can be achieved.

Impacts on Blood Sugar and Insulin Levels

The study documented the therapeutic effects of Virechana on blood glucose levels in a 57-year-old female patient suffering from Type 2 diabetes. Initial assessments indicated elevated fasting and post-prandial blood sugar levels. Following the Virechana treatment, the patient's fasting blood sugar levels dropped from 141 mg/dl to 113 mg/dl, while post-prandial levels decreased from 242 mg/dl to 170 mg/dl. Additionally, serum insulin levels showed a significant decrease, indicating improved metabolic control and reduced insulin resistance post-treatment. This highlights the efficacy of Ayurvedic interventions in managing diabetes by targeting underlying metabolic imbalances.

Regulating Body Composition

The effects of the Ayurvedic treatment were also observed in the patient's body composition, particularly in her Body Mass Index (BMI) and waist-to-hip ratio (W:H ratio). Throughout the treatment, the patient's weight decreased from 73 kg to 68 kg, resulting in an improved BMI from 30 to 27.3. This reduction in body weight and modifications in waist circumference suggest not only a direct impact on obesity but also a correlation with enhancements in metabolic health, demonstrating the holistic approach of Ayurveda in managing lifestyle-related disorders like diabetes.

Conclusion

This case study illuminates the potential of Ayurvedic therapeutic interventions, particularly Virechana, in managing Sthula Madhumeha. The observed improvements in blood sugar levels, insulin resistance, and body composition underscore the effectiveness of traditional practices in contemporary health care. However, since this study was conducted on a single patient, further research on a larger sample size is necessary to substantiate these findings and develop conclusive treatment recommendations. The integration of Ayurveda into modern diabetes management might offer new avenues for comprehensive care and prevention strategies.

FAQ section (important questions/answers):

What is the relationship between Diabetes Mellitus and Madhumeha?

Diabetes Mellitus is similar to Madhumeha in Ayurvedic terms, characterized by hyperglycemia. Charak classified Madhumeha into Sthula and Krisha types based on their management, indicating that Shodhana (purification) treatment is appropriate for Sthula Madhumeha.

What is Virechana in Ayurvedic treatment?

Virechana is a detoxification process aimed at cleansing the body of excess Kapha and Kleda. It helps in stabilizing metabolic functions and reducing symptoms associated with Sthula Madhumeha by facilitating the expulsion of morbid doshas.

How does obesity affect insulin resistance in diabetes?

Obesity, particularly intra-abdominal fat, releases free fatty acids that compete with glucose for oxidation. This competition leads to impaired insulin signaling, causing reduced glucose utilization and increased glucose production, contributing to hyperglycemia and insulin resistance.

What were the results of the case study on Virechana?

Results indicated significant reductions in blood sugar levels, serum insulin, and HOMA-IR values. The patient also showed decreased body mass index (BMI) and improvement in various symptoms of Sthula Madhumeha after Virechana treatment.

What are some key symptoms of Sthula Madhumeha addressed in the treatment?

Key symptoms include weight gain, fatigue, increased hunger, and excessive sweating. The treatment aimed to alleviate these symptoms through dietary management, herbal medications, and detoxification procedures like Virechana.

What further research is suggested based on the study findings?

The study suggests conducting larger sample size investigations to establish the effectiveness of Ayurvedic treatments like Virechana for managing Sthula Madhumeha, as results from this case study were promising but not definitive.
